The speech of US Vice-President JD Vance in Munich, yesterday, 14 February 2025 was historic. Vance pointed to the European governments’ and the EU’s undemocratic actions, to censorship, to thought crimes, to election annulation, etc. Vance approached these European tendencies in a comparison to the former Soviet Union. This comparison sounds radical and has been immediately slammed the European press and governments. This criticism and Vance’s call to allow all opinions to count in Europe have been, in particular, received with shock in Germany. Vance suggested to Germany to tear down firewalls, in other words to allow the AfD to participate in the political discussions and not to outlaw them or to call them anticonstitutional for their opinion, telling that Germany’s law on hate speech is the instrument to abusively control dissenting opinions. Vance called for the American democratic freedom of speech to be law in Europe. In view of the upcoming elections in Germany, the current Ampel coalition of Greens/Leftists and Chancellor Scholz accused Vance of election meddling, crying foul. “German chancellor Olaf Scholz on Saturday shot back strongly in defence of his stance against the far-right and said his country will not accept people who “intervene in our democracy,” a day after US vice-president JD Vance scolded European leaders over their approach to democracy.”
